I don't think I saw anyone report speed problems in IPoIB in 2.6.16
- and with TCP performance really depends on the setup/software, so why don't
you just install several kernels and try them all out?

I recall some people saw performance degradation on some network
topologies after Linux fixed the ack stretch violation in 2.6.11 or so.
If you go 2.6.18.1, you have the added bonus of upstream IPoIB code basically
identical to that of OFED 1.1.
